dead-code: remove .clip-template-lint orphan + extract clipTemplateGuideBtn margin

The .clip-template-lint CSS rule was documented as a no-op alias kept in case any external reference still used it (deprecated when the shared .template-lint class with .ok/.warn modifiers took over). Grep confirms zero external references — both .ts files and index.html only mention the new .template-lint class. Deleted the rule + its 5-line comment.

Same edit moves the clipTemplateGuideBtn's margin-top:8px from inline to a .clip-template-wrap .btn-secondary descendant rule. One inline style attribute gone, and the spacing now lives next to the .clip-template-wrap definition where future readers will look for it.

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
This commit is contained in:
xRangerDE 2026-05-11 07:22:36 +02:00
parent f3e7225011
commit 3e5bdb73d4
2 changed files with 8 additions and 11 deletions

View File

@ -103,7 +103,7 @@
<input type="text" id="clipFilenameTemplate" value="{date}_{part}.mp4" placeholder="{date}_{part}.mp4" class="clip-modal-template-input" oninput="updateFilenameExamples()"> <input type="text" id="clipFilenameTemplate" value="{date}_{part}.mp4" placeholder="{date}_{part}.mp4" class="clip-modal-template-input" oninput="updateFilenameExamples()">
<div id="clipTemplateHelp" class="clip-modal-hint">Platzhalter: {title} {id} {channel} {date} {part} {trim_start} {trim_end} {trim_length} {date_custom="yyyy-MM-dd"}</div> <div id="clipTemplateHelp" class="clip-modal-hint">Platzhalter: {title} {id} {channel} {date} {part} {trim_start} {trim_end} {trim_length} {date_custom="yyyy-MM-dd"}</div>
<div id="clipTemplateLint" class="template-lint ok">Template-Check: OK</div> <div id="clipTemplateLint" class="template-lint ok">Template-Check: OK</div>
<button class="btn-secondary" id="clipTemplateGuideBtn" style="margin-top: 8px;" onclick="openTemplateGuide('clip')">Template Guide</button> <button class="btn-secondary" id="clipTemplateGuideBtn" onclick="openTemplateGuide('clip')">Template Guide</button>
</div> </div>
</div> </div>

View File

@ -323,20 +323,17 @@ body {
line-height: 1.4; line-height: 1.4;
} }
/* .clip-template-lint was the old per-modal rule for the clip-cutter
template lint badge. Superseded by the shared .template-lint
class (with .ok / .warn modifiers driven from var(--success) /
var(--error)). Class kept as a no-op alias in case any external
reference still uses it. */
.clip-template-lint {
font-size: 12px;
margin-top: 4px;
}
.clip-template-wrap { .clip-template-wrap {
margin-top: 10px; margin-top: 10px;
} }
/* Template-Guide button below the clip-template input small offset
from the lint badge that sits directly above it. Was a one-off
inline style on the button. */
.clip-template-wrap .btn-secondary {
margin-top: 8px;
}
.clip-radio-row { .clip-radio-row {
display: flex; display: flex;
align-items: center; align-items: center;